Transaction 305cf16060e9a38f72cdc664c1018782b67e9d352718be619121c41c29b5263f
1 Input
1 Output
-
305cf16060e9a38f72cdc664c1018782b67e9d352718be619121c41c29b5263f:0
- value
- 108278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52848b38c5d25b75e4fcb8eda3501f8f719df202 OP_EQUAL
- address
- 39DL7aebD5vvSWLCbH4eSx3o2KCXU7WpRt